Find hotels in Stokes Bay from AED 1,815
- Plan, book, stay with confidence
Be picky
Search almost a million properties worldwide
Change your mind
Book hotels with free cancellation
Check prices for these dates
Compare 70 hotels, room rates, hotel reviews and availability. Most hotels are fully refundable.

Wander On Kangaroo Island
Wander On Kangaroo Island
9.4 out of 10, Exceptional, (3)
The price is AED 2,145
AED 2,145 total
includes taxes & fees
13 Mar - 14 Mar

Sky House Kangaroo Island
Sky House Kangaroo Island
10.0 out of 10, Exceptional, (15)
The price is AED 1,815
AED 1,815 total
includes taxes & fees
13 Mar - 14 Mar

Emu Bay Holiday Homes
Emu Bay Holiday Homes
10.0 out of 10, Exceptional, (33)
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Learn more about Stokes Bay
Connect with nature in this cozy waterfront community and check out a conservation park, wildlife sanctuary, pretty bush gardens and an idyllic beach.

More cheap stays in Stokes Bay
More cheap stays in Stokes Bay
Emu Bay Lodge
39 Hamilton Drive, Emu Bay, SA
Recent reviews of Stokes Bay hotels
Recent reviews of Stokes Bay hotels

Private Beach Retreat Dome, 2 minutes walk to stunning Snelling Beach
5/5 Excellent
Top spot!
"What a blissful retreat this place is! Perfect for couples, right on the gorgeous beach and across the road from the Fig Tree which is well worth a visit. The Dome is comfy with every need catered for. "
A verified traveler stayed at Private Beach Retreat Dome, 2 minutes walk to stunning Snelling Beach
Posted 1 month ago
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Stay near popular Stokes Bay attractions
- Hotels near Flinders Chase National Park
- Hotels near Snelling Beach
- Hotels near Kangaroo Island Wildlife Park
- Hotels near King George Beach
- Hotels near Exceptional Kangaroo Island
- Hotels near Raptor Domain
- Hotels near Little Sahara
- Hotels near Parndana Golf Course
- Hotels near Parndana Soldier Settlement Museum
Hotels near Stokes Bay Airports
Stokes Bay Hotels by Brand
Other Hotels near Stokes Bay, South Australia
- Kangaroo Island Hotels
- Yorke Peninsula Hotels
- Emu Bay Hotels
- Vivonne Bay Hotels
- Karatta Hotels
- Seddon Hotels
- Middle River Hotels
- Macgillivray Hotels
- Cygnet River Hotels
- Cassini Hotels
- Menzies Hotels
- Newland Hotels
- Western River Hotels
- Flinders Chase Hotels
- Seal Bay Hotels
- Gosse Hotels
- Parndana Hotels
- Seal Bay Conservation Park Hotels
Explore more hotels
- Fairfield House - 17 Rookery Road
- King George Beach Retreat
- Apartment amongst the Kangaroos and only a 3 minute walk to Snelling Beach
- Morry's Beachside Getaway | Emu Bay | Kangaroo Island
- Sky House Kangaroo Island
- Stunning beachfront home - Pet friendly
- Hamilton | Emu Bay | beachfront getaway | accommodates 10 guests
- Sea's The Day - Emu Bay Kangaroo Island
- Sheoaks - Snellings Beach - Kangaroo Island
- Villa By the Sea-4 Bedrooms -Sea View Rural View 2 minutes walk to EmuBay beach
- Emu Bay Stay - beach house in the dunes
- Settlers Cottage - Snellings Beach - Kangaroo Island